The main issue I have is computing the total_size of valid files that
will be checksummed and that exist in both the manifests and the
backup, in the case of a tar backup. This cannot be done in the same
way as with a plain backup.

Another consideration is that, in the case of a tar backup, since
we're reading all tar files from the backup rather than individual
files to be checksummed, should we consider total_size as the sum of
all valid tar files in the backup, regardless of checksum
verification? If so, we would need to perform an initial pass to
calculate the total_size in the directory, similar to what
verify_backup_directory() does., but doing so I am a bit uncomfortable
and unsure if we should do that pass.

An alternative idea is to provide progress reports per file instead of
for the entire backup directory. We could report the size of each file
and keep track of done_size as we read each tar header and content.
For example, the report could be:

109032/109032 kB (100%) base.tar file verified
123444/123444 kB (100%) 16245.tar file verified
23478/23478 kB (100%) 16246.tar file verified
.....
<total_done_size>/<total_size>  (NNN%) verified.

I think this type of reporting can be implemented with minimal
changes, abd for plain backups, we can keep the reporting as it is.
Thoughts?
